The Obama administration’s decision today authorizing nearly 1,300 new natural gas wells in Utah’s Desolation Canyon wilderness and other remote areas will degrade the pristine region’s air quality and hurt the state’s tourism industry, according to a coalition of environmental groups.

Next week, the Bureau of Land Management (BLM) will hold two public meetings in Utah to take comments on its 2012 Oil Shale and Tar Sands Draft Programmatic Environmental Impact Statement (Draft PEIS). Please come and make sure your voice is heard in favor of protecting Utah’s redrock wilderness!

In early February, SUWA petitioned a little-known state agency to protect the mighty Colorado and Green Rivers from activities like oil and gas leasing.
